Challenge: a new study of fear speech is under-resourced and fragmented. authors review existing definitions and propose a taxonomy that consolidates different dimensions of fear.
Approach: They propose a taxonomy that consolidates different dimensions of fear for studying fear speech.
Outcome: The proposed taxonomy consolidates different dimensions of fear for studying fear speech.

When Words Wear Masks: Detecting Malicious Intents and Hostile Impacts of Online Hate Speech (2026.eacl-short)

Copied to clipboard

Challenge: Existing methods for hate speech detection treat hate speech as a monolithic phenomenon, ignoring the speaker’s motivations and potential societal consequences.
Approach: They propose a dataset with a dual taxonomy that separates Intent (why the speaker produced hate speech) and Impact (what harm it may cause to individuals and communities) they propose to use this data to enable content moderation and user safety.
Outcome: The proposed dataset captures Intent (why the speaker produced hate speech) and Impact (what harm it may cause to individuals and communities) of online hateful posts.
Emotion Analysis in NLP: Trends, Gaps and Roadmap for Future Directions (2024.lrec-main)

Copied to clipboard

Challenge: Emotion analysis (EA) is a rapidly growing field in natural language processing . there is no consensus on scope, direction, or methods for EA .
Approach: They review 154 relevant NLP papers on emotion analysis from the last decade . they ask: how are EA tasks defined in NLP? what are the most prominent emotion frameworks and which emotions are modeled?
Outcome: The authors examine 154 relevant NLP papers on emotion analysis from the last decade . they find that there is no consensus on scope, direction, or methods .
